Description
At Kargo, our mission is to build a connective tissue between the physical world of freight and the digital ecosystem used to manage it. We believe that advancements in smart infrastructure are critical to enabling a safer and more efficient future for logistics. Our loading dock sensor platform verifies all incoming and outgoing freight, aggregating data that enables shippers and carriers to efficiently manage dock operations, switch out suppliers and understand material flow in real time.

Responsibilities
- Build high-performance C++ systems for machine vision and AI on edge devices, processing gigabytes of data per second.
- Develop advanced perception systems using 3D computer vision.
- Build agentic AI systems to deploy, manage, and monitor a growing fleet of edge devices operating in real-world environments.
- Design and implement scalable software for distributed edge infrastructure and device management.
- Optimize system performance, reliability, and scalability across hardware and software.
- Collaborate cross-functionally with engineering and product teams to deliver production-ready solutions.
- Mentor junior engineers through code reviews, technical guidance, and engineering best practices.
Experience
- 5+ years of software engineering experience.
- Strong proficiency in C++ and modern software development practices.
- Experience building production systems on Linux.
- Experience designing scalable, distributed software systems.
- Experience with one or more of the following: computer vision, machine learning or AI, robotics, or edge computing.
- Strong debugging, performance optimization, and problem-solving skills.
- Degree or Masters in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Robotics, or related field.
